UBS Factor MSCI USA Quality Screened UCITS ETF hGBP dis
What this fund is
UBS Factor MSCI USA Quality Screened UCITS ETF hGBP dis is an exchange-traded fund (ETF) from UBS, traded under the ticker UQLT (ISIN IE00BXDZNK39). One trade buys a whole basket of holdings, so your money is spread out instead of riding on a single company. In plain terms it is about owning small slices of companies, so you share in their growth when they do well — and their falls when they don't, spread across its target market. Rather than a manager picking stocks, it simply replicates the MSCI USA Quality index — the passive, low-cost approach, and its largest holdings include NVIDIA CORP, APPLE INC and MICROSOFT CORP. Geographically it leans ~46.2% United States.
Its heaviest sectors are ~37.1% Technology and ~6.3% Health Care. It is commonly used to tilt a portfolio towards one market, usually alongside broader, more global funds rather than on its own. Its ongoing charge (TER) is 0.28% a year — about €28 a year on a €10,000 holding, taken automatically from the fund. Income such as dividends is paid out to you as cash (a distributing share class). It holds the underlying investments directly (physical replication); it is domiciled in Ireland and UCITS-regulated, a European standard built to protect everyday investors and trades in GBP.
Its price has swung about 13.8% over the past year, which describes how much its price tends to move rather than whether it is good. It launched in 2016. As with any investment, its value can go down as well as up, and past performance is not a guide to future results. (Fund data sourced from UBS.)
